From 29a0082ebf76e7a6b2be48764d058276ac9f79fb Mon Sep 17 00:00:00 2001 From: kemuru <102478601+kemuru@users.noreply.github.com> Date: Thu, 10 Apr 2025 17:54:53 +0200 Subject: [PATCH] fix: court name --- web/src/pages/Courts/CourtDetails/StakePanel/index.tsx | 4 ++-- web/src/pages/Courts/CourtDetails/index.tsx | 9 +++++---- 2 files changed, 7 insertions(+), 6 deletions(-) diff --git a/web/src/pages/Courts/CourtDetails/StakePanel/index.tsx b/web/src/pages/Courts/CourtDetails/StakePanel/index.tsx index c62a89570..fb5294d65 100644 --- a/web/src/pages/Courts/CourtDetails/StakePanel/index.tsx +++ b/web/src/pages/Courts/CourtDetails/StakePanel/index.tsx @@ -44,7 +44,7 @@ const InputArea = styled(TagArea)` flex-direction: column; `; -const StakePanel: React.FC<{ courtName: string }> = ({ courtName = "Unknown Court" }) => { +const StakePanel: React.FC<{ courtName: string | undefined }> = ({ courtName }) => { const [amount, setAmount] = useState(""); const [isActive, setIsActive] = useState(true); const [action, setAction] = useState(ActionType.stake); @@ -65,7 +65,7 @@ const StakePanel: React.FC<{ courtName: string }> = ({ courtName = "Unknown Cour diff --git a/web/src/pages/Courts/CourtDetails/index.tsx b/web/src/pages/Courts/CourtDetails/index.tsx index 76f285677..cb71d1308 100644 --- a/web/src/pages/Courts/CourtDetails/index.tsx +++ b/web/src/pages/Courts/CourtDetails/index.tsx @@ -8,7 +8,6 @@ import { Card, Breadcrumb } from "@kleros/ui-components-library"; import { isProductionDeployment } from "consts/index"; -import { useCourtPolicy } from "queries/useCourtPolicy"; import { useCourtTree, CourtTreeQuery } from "queries/useCourtTree"; import { landscapeStyle } from "styles/landscapeStyle"; @@ -99,7 +98,6 @@ const StakePanelAndStats = styled.div` const CourtDetails: React.FC = () => { const { id } = useParams(); - const { data: policy } = useCourtPolicy(id); const { data } = useCourtTree(); const [isStakingMiniGuideOpen, toggleStakingMiniGuide] = useToggle(false); const navigate = useNavigate(); @@ -112,13 +110,16 @@ const CourtDetails: React.FC = () => { value: node.id, })) ?? []; + const currentCourt = courtPath?.[courtPath.length - 1]; + const courtName = currentCourt?.name; + return ( - {policy ? policy.name : } + {data ? courtName : } {breadcrumbItems.length > 1 ? ( { - +